Lewisham Southwark College (LeSoCo) is a further education college in Lewisham and Southwark, south-east London. The college was formed from the merger of Lewisham College and Southwark College.

Campus

Lewisham Southwark College is located in the London Borough of Lewisham and the London Borough of Southwark in south-east London. The college comprise campuses in Lewisham Way, New Cross, Deptford Church Street, Waterloo and Camberwell. The college mainly serves students living in the local communities of Lewisham, Greenwich and Southwark,[1]

Students

The College has 16,000 student enrolments and 36,000 course enrolments. The college was a member of the 157 Group of high performing schools.[2]

  • 39% study full-time
  • 61% part-time
  • Average age 29
  • 57% from ethnic minorities
  • 41% from Lewisham
  • 13% from Southwark
  • 11% from Greenwich
  • 59% male 41% female
  • 644 full-time equivalent staff
  • 5 campuses
